Question
Give two confirmatory tests for chloride ion.
Short Answer
Advertisements
Solution
- Silver Nitrate Test: Add silver nitrate (AgNO3) solution to the salt solution. A curdy white precipitate of silver chloride (AgCl)) forms, which dissolves completely in excess ammonium hydroxide (NH4OH).
- Chromyl Chloride Test: Heat the dry salt with solid potassium dichromate (K2Cr2O7) and concentrated sulphuric acid. Distinct reddish-brown vapours of chromyl chloride (CrO2Cl2) will evolve.
